Hydrolyzed Human Placental Protein

INCI: HYDROLYZED HUMAN PLACENTAL PROTEIN

CAS Number
91080-01-2 (general placental protein hydrolysate)
Function
Skin conditioning agent
Safety Rating
POOR

Regulatory Status

๐Ÿ‡ช๐Ÿ‡บ EU Status prohibited
๐Ÿ‡บ๐Ÿ‡ธ US Status permitted
US Notes Insufficient data โ€” CIR Final Report concluded data are insufficient to support safety; additional sensitization, repeated-dose, repro/dev tox, genotoxicity, and photosensitization studies are needed

Expert Verdict

CIR deemed unsafe with current data; EU-prohibited; human-origin disease transmission risk; estrogenic and biologically active substance concerns; incompatible with COSMOS/ECOCERT certification
